Job Description

Preschool Assistant Teacher Lenexa, KS Job Details Part-time $13 - $15 an hour 1 day ago Qualifications Behavior management Teamwork Teacher collaboration Active listening High school diploma or GED Cleaning Preschool teaching Equipment maintenance Classroom behavior management Facilities maintenance Entry level Time management Full Job Description The Community Covenant Church Preschool and PDO Assistant Teacher provides quality support, supervision and leadership to the children, and the classroom, while creating a nurturing and Christian atmosphere.
Position:
Preschool Assistant Teacher is a part-time position that operates from August-May. 2 or 3 days per week 8:15-2:30pm
Supervision Received:
You will report to the Program Director and in collaboration with other staff members. Essential Duties and Responsibilities The Assistant Teacher will: Meet the physical, emotional, social, intellectual and spiritual needs of the children Assist the Lead Teacher by ensuring that room preparation of equipment and activities are available daily Follow a daily classroom schedule, but is flexible when it changes Ensure that equipment and facilities are cleaned, well maintained and safe at all times Be familiar with emergency procedures Build children's self-esteem, while always making sure they feel comfortable and safe Establish routines and provide positive guidance Monitor and recognize classroom behaviors. Adapt accordingly Clearly and effectively communicate Participate in Preschool Community activities Attend monthly Staff Meetings Attend Required Training Agree to be Background Checked and Fingerprinted Knowledge, Skills and Abilities The Assistant Teacher must have: Experience in Early Childhood A High School Diploma or GED A positive attitude, high level of integrity, honesty, and work ethic A caring, loving and nurturing personality Strong verbal and listening skills A strong ability to effectively handle issues amongst children in the classroom The ability to multitask A strong sense of time management Be compassionate and understanding Ability to work cooperatively with the Lead Teacher and other staff Essential Physical Requirements The Assistant Teacher must have: Lift and carry up to 20 lbs. Stand on your feet for long periods of time Be able to get up and down from the floor multiple times Bend and stoop to assist children Use a pleasant and clearly understandable speaking voice
